The Queens Head, Dogmersfield, near Fleet, Hampshire dates from the 17th Century and many of the original features still remain today. With a cosy, traditional interior, covered terrace and large scenic gardens the pub is a welcoming place to relax. Our pub commemorates the visit of Catherine of Aragon, who would later become Henry VIII's first wife
